PARTICIPANT FEATURE
HCVP participant and resident of Cleveland Heights Cecelia Price recently graduated from the Family Self-Sufficiency (FSS) program. After graduation, she plans to buy her first home. Price obtained her Associate’s Degree in Nursing in May of 2018, opened a checking and savings account and raised her credit score during her time as a FSS participant. She believes the program was extremely beneficial and adamantly encourages other residents to get involved. Price joined the HCVP program in her early 20s as a single mother and was able to move for better access to schools. The FSS program, which changed her life in a way that she could not imagine, expanded her network and provided education on budgeting, interviewing skills, homeownership and more. Price acknowledges CMHA and the FSS staff for helping her to set and reach goals! |

LANDLORD PORTAL
All landlords are encouraged to visit the Landlord Portal and review information the HCVP has on record. If necessary, update the Portal with new phone numbers, email addresses and mailing addresses as soon as possible. To register for the Landlord Portal, visit www.cmha.net/LLportal.
RENT DETERMINATION REQUESTS
We are excited to announce that you can submit a rent adjustment request online in the landlord portal. The user-friendly process keeps you informed every step of the way; check the status of a request, see the proposed effective date of a request or check the reason a request is pending. In order to use the feature, you must have a registered landlord portal account.
APPLICANT PORTAL
Also, all applicants are encouraged to visit the Applicant Portal and review information that is on record. Please update the Portal with new phone numbers, email addresses and mailing addresses as soon as possible at www.cmha.net/apportal
PARTICIPANT PORTAL
Participants will be able to complete various online forms, but you will also be able to view certification details and utility information, view your next recertification date, download a copy of your HAP contract and more at www.cmha.net/apportal |
